Learning About the Duties of an Insurance Broker
An insurance broker serves as a middleman between clients and insurers, guaranteeing that businesses and individuals find the most suitable protection for their requirements. Their main role includes evaluating customers' needs, analyzing different insurance options, and presenting tailored options. Agents have in-depth knowledge of the insurance industry, which enables them to traverse complicated policies and spot potential holes in coverage.
Clients benefit from brokers' knowledge as they obtain personalized advice and recommendations. Additionally, brokers advocate for their clients, negotiating terms and pricing with insurance companies to secure best arrangements. They also assist in claims processes, providing support to clients during challenging times. Significantly, insurance brokers must comply with industry regulations and copyright ethical practices, ensuring transparency and trust in their connections. By doing so, they play a vital role in helping clients make informed decisions regarding their insurance requirements.

Pricing and Coverage Information
Knowing the amount and premium details of an insurance policy is necessary for consumers pursuing comprehensive coverage. When partnering with an insurance broker, consumers should question the aspects that shape costs, such as age, health, and policy ceilings. They should also obtain a itemization of the cost structure, including any discounts available for packaged coverage or safe practices. Moreover, clients should clarify the payment options—whether monthly, quarterly, or annually—and any fines for late payments. Grasping how insurance claims influence future premiums is vital. In essence, asking these key questions helps clients reach smart conclusions, making certain they opt for a coverage option that corresponds to their financial capabilities and protection requirements. Solid communication with the broker can result in considerable savings and improved protection.

Common Questions That Are Often Asked
In What Manner Do Insurance Brokers Collect Earnings?
Insurance representatives usually earn commissions from insurance companies tied to the policies they sell. They may also levy fees for specific services or consultations, offering incentives for brokers to offer tailored coverage solutions to clients.
Can I Change Brokers Easily?
Switching brokers is generally simple. Clients can tell their current broker, choose a new one, and shift their policies. However, reviewing any contractual obligations and likely fees is wise before taking the change.
What if I'm denied coverage?
If denied coverage, individuals should first request an detailed explanation from their insurance provider. Considering different insurers or policies can also prove beneficial, as well as engaging an insurance broker for specialized guidance and workable remedies.
Are Insurance Brokers Qualified Licensed Professionals?
Yes, insurance agents are certified experts. They must meet specific educational requirements and pass examinations to guarantee they comprehend the intricacies of insurance offerings, allowing them to provide informed guidance to customers looking for coverage options.
How Regularly Must I Evaluate My Policy?
Individuals must assess their insurance policies annually or when significant life changes happen, such as wedlock or property acquisition. Regular assessments guarantee coverage proves to be adequate, pertinent, and economical, aligning with evolving personal circumstances and financial aspirations.
